0:04 Those who live by disruption die by disruption.
0:08 If you're involved in that, that's the Fate you're gonna meet.
0:12 It's like being a soldier with the sword, you gotta expect that battlefield.
0:15 And design fictions, are a part of that;
0:18 they're a part of the startup disruption world.
0:21 They do not stabilize the situation, they destabilize it.
0:25 You will never see a design fiction which is about getting married, buying a house, having kids, and living in a stable environment, with Civil Rights.
0:37 You're never gonna hear a design fiction on that topic.
0:40 Why don't design fiction people do that?
0:42 Why don't you find that interesting?
0:44 Why don't we do stuff like that?
0:45 Why is design fiction always full of wow, and amazingness?
0:52 Kind of a good question.
0:55 Well, I'm gonna tell you why, and it's gonna kind of hurt.
1:01 In the startup world, you work hard and you move fast, in order to make other people rich.
1:08 Other people, not you;
1:11 you're a small elite of very smart young people who are working very hard, for an even smaller elite, of mostly baby boomer financiers.
1:23 So they can buy national governments, shut the governments down, destroy the middle class and the Nation State.
1:31 That's been going on a long time.
1:35 It's not something you invented, that's a historical development.
1:38 There's a lot of reasons that the Nation State's gotta go, there's a lot of reasons why a middle class is in the way.
1:45 But that's what you do.
1:46 And that'll be the judgement of history for your startup culture.
1:50 They're gonna say: "the TwentyTeens were all about that."
1:53 It was a tacit allegiance between the hacker space favelas of the startups, and offshore capital and tax avoidance money laundries.
2:04 And what were they doing?
2:06 They were building a globalized network society.
2:10 And that's what's coming next, an actual globalized network society,
2:14 now you're routing around it from the bottom, while they climb over it from the top.
2:19 But you're both aimed in the same direction.
2:21 That's why you're in tacit allegiance, whether you know it or not.
2:24 And right now everybody lives the way that people used to live under Empires and Colonial States.
2:32 We're all autoColonialized by The Austerity.
2:40 That's your big dragon.
2:43 That's your actual dragon.
2:46 Not like the little tactical dragon, that's the big dragon.
2:49 And you know it's the big dragon, 'cause you're part of it.
2:52 You're actually its brain and its nervous system.
2:56 You.
2:59 And as long as you are making rich guys richer, you are not disrupting the Austerity.
3:08 You are one of its top facilitators.
